Hammer Plus, its a basic nelson clone. Just like a trracer or maverick, only these take Spyder threaded barrels, and have a powerfeed (on a pump.. why!?!)

I believe the plus was the powerfeed, as well as a metal grip-frame (not sure on the last part)

Decent pumps, some upgradability (as far as nelson bore drop pumps go)

Not a bad buy, if the price is right.

nelson clone refers to the valve style. The nelson part of it refers to the Nelspot 707 (1950'-1960's?) and the Nelspot 007 (late 70's through 80's). This similar valve system can be found in 90% of your single tube pumps, such as the CCI pahntom.

You can get adapters to run one on 12gram co2 carts, which I preffer because of the light weight. costs a bit more, but sometimes worth it. Plus, 12g's have a tiny bit of oil in them, and it keeps your gun running in tip-top shape.

I had one, they are a good gun but the powerfeed gets all up in your face. Try to find the older hammers because they are better built and don't have a power feed on them. You can put any barrel you like on it because it accepts spyder barrels.

All hammers take spyder threaded barrels EXCEPT the Hammer 2. That has similar threads, but the breach end is too long. Its really just a Sterling clone and quite rare.

And if you find a Hammer 3... ooooh boy, thats a good find. It was an inline semi, like an XTS. never seen one except for in an old ad, so if you find one, I want a picture :)
